Yo-yo's - The Wedge surf guide

Yo-yo's - The Wedge is a popular surf spot located in Sekongkang Bay, known for its unique wave formation. The area is a swell magnet, benefiting from the underwater geography and the cliffs that frame the bay. Surfers come here to enjoy the action, especially when conditions align, making it an interesting place for both locals and visitors.

The Wedge works well with SouthWest swells, although it can also handle swells coming from the South and West. It handles swell sizes around 2ft (0.6m) but can generate some decent waves when the conditions are right. The wave breaks over an uneven reef, providing a punchy right that has a steep drop, ending abruptly. A NorthWest wind is preferred here, and the waves can be surfed during low, mid, or high tide. This spot is best suited for intermediate surfers who are comfortable navigating through the short, fast rides.

When youโ€™re out at Yo-yo's, be aware that the surf can change quickly with different swells, so keep an eye on the conditions. It's a great spot if you're looking to sharpen your skills on a short punchy wave, but it does require a bit of experience to make the most of it.
